January
- Update your student résumé. Include all accomplishments and activities from fall semester.
- Based on last semester’s grades, join academic programs and organizations that recognize high-achieving students. See your high school counselor for instructions on membership.
- Check with your high school/college-career counselor on your progress with achieving your four-year plan. Update your four-year plan to match revisions made to your education / career goals.
- Study hard this spring semester to earn top grades so you can have the highest possible GPA and class rank.
- Continue to develop respectful, hard-working relationships with your teachers. Good relationships result in superior letters of recommendation when you apply for college admission and scholarships.
- Apply for college summer enrichment programs of interest. Meet all application deadlines.
- Continue participating in extracurricular activities (inside and outside of school). Dedicate yourself to a few extracurricular activities and work toward leadership positions. Leadership is one of the most valuable student qualification sought by college admission officers.
- Take SAT Subject Test(s)™ this month (if you have transition block scheduling and registered to take SAT Subject Test(s)™).
